I’ve seen a few attempts at making procedural racing games based on street map data from Google Maps and other sources [1] [2], but because the maps are often imprecise from a collision standpoint, the results can tend to be pretty janky.

Unfortunately I can't really give any meaningful feedback on this game because every time I try to start a race, it just shows a character parachuting down...
